Understanding Sentiment Analysis: The Basics
In today’s digital landscape, businesses are continually seeking innovative methods to gain insights into customer opinions and experiences. One effective technique is analyzing customer feedback and reviews with sentiment analysis. Sentiment analysis involves the use of natural language processing and machine learning to determine the emotional tone behind words, allowing organizations to classify customer sentiments as positive, negative, or neutral. By implementing this technology, businesses can effectively decipher vast amounts of customer feedback from various sources, including social media, online reviews, and surveys. Understanding sentiment analysis not only enhances customer engagement strategies but also drives product development and marketing efforts, ensuring that brands remain attuned to the ever-evolving preferences of their clientele.

How Sentiment Analysis Works in Processing Reviews
Sentiment analysis is a powerful tool in the realm of analyzing customer feedback and reviews with sentiment analysis. This technique leverages natural language processing (NLP) and machine learning algorithms to interpret and classify the emotional tone behind customer opinions in written texts. By breaking down reviews into sentiment categories—such as positive, negative, or neutral—businesses can gain valuable insights into customer perceptions and experiences. The process typically begins with data collection, where thousands of reviews are aggregated from sources such as social media, product pages, or customer surveys. Next, the text is processed to remove any irrelevant information and to normalize it for easier analysis. Advanced algorithms then evaluate the sentiment expressed in the text, often utilizing a combination of linguistic rules and predefined sentiment lexicons. This comprehensive analysis enables companies to identify trends, address customer concerns, and enhance their products or services based on genuine feedback, thereby improving overall customer satisfaction.
